Abstract

The utility model discloses a kind of height-adjustable weaving creels, including babinet, the bottom of the cabinets cavity is fixedly connected with holder, it is fixedly connected with motor at the top of the holder, the output end of the motor is fixedly connected with runner, the front of the runner is fixedly connected with pivot pin, and the surface of the pivot pin slidably connects activity box, connecting rod is fixedly connected on the left of the activity box.The utility model is by being arranged being used cooperatively for motor, runner, pivot pin, activity box, connecting rod, mobile bar, motion bar, movable plate and movable plate, it is height-adjustable to solve the problems, such as that existing weaving creel does not have, the height-adjustable weaving creel, has height-adjustable advantage, tube is placed or removed convenient for staff, reduce the generation of peril, reduce the working strength of staff, it improves work efficiency, the development and use for being conducive to textile mills, are worth of widely use.

A kind of height-adjustable weaving creel
Technical field
The utility model is related to textile technology field, specially a kind of height-adjustable weaving creel.
Background technology
Weaving original meaning is taken from the general name of spinning and woven fabric, but with the continuous hair of textile knowledge system and subject system Exhibition and perfect, after the technologies such as especially non-woven textile material and three-dimensional be composite braided generate, weaving is not only traditional spinning And woven fabric, also include nonwoven fabric technology, three dimensional weaving technique, electrostatic nano-netting technology etc..
With the development of the society, textile industry obtains larger development, in fabrication processes, the tube needs for winding of spinning are put It sets on creel, carry out the processing of next step or is sold as semi-finished product, therefore weaving creel is in textile manufacturing engineering Essential, however existing weaving creel does not have height-adjustable advantage, be not easy to staff place or Person removes tube, can also increase the generation of peril, increases the working strength of staff, reduces working efficiency, no Conducive to the development and use of textile mills.
Invention content
The purpose of this utility model is to provide a kind of height-adjustable weaving creels, have height-adjustable excellent It is height-adjustable to solve the problems, such as that existing weaving creel does not have for point.
To achieve the above object, the utility model provides the following technical solutions:A kind of height-adjustable weaving creel, Including babinet, the bottom of the cabinets cavity is fixedly connected with holder, and motor, the electricity are fixedly connected at the top of the holder The output end of machine is fixedly connected with runner, and the front of the runner is fixedly connected with pivot pin, and the surface of the pivot pin is slidably connected There is activity box, connecting rod is fixedly connected on the left of the activity box, mobile bar, institute are fixedly connected on the left of the connecting rod The bottom for stating mobile bar is fixedly connected with the first sliding block, and the bottom of the cabinets cavity offers the first sliding groove, and the first sliding groove Inner wall connect with the basal sliding of the first sliding block, the first strut is fixedly connected at the top of the mobile bar, in the babinet Fixed block is fixedly connected on the left of chamber, side of the fixed block far from babinet is connected with motion bar, the motion bar Front offer the first loose slot, and the inner wall of the first loose slot and the surface of the first strut are slidably connected, the motion bar One end far from fixed block is fixedly connected with the second strut, and the inner cavity of the babinet is provided with movable plate, the bottom of the movable plate Portion is fixedly connected with movable plate, and the front of the movable plate offers the second loose slot, and the inner wall of the second loose slot and second The surface of strut is slidably connected, and the both sides of the movable plate have been fixedly connected with the second sliding block, and the both sides of the cabinets cavity are equal Second sliding slot is offered, and the inner wall of second sliding slot is slidably connected with side of second sliding block far from movable plate, the babinet Top offers straight slot, and portable pillar is fixedly connected at the top of the movable plate, straight slot is through at the top of the portable pillar Top is simultaneously fixedly connected with support plate, and the both sides at the top of the support plate have been fixedly connected with rack.
Preferably, the both sides of the bottom of box have been fixedly connected with trapezoid block, and the bottom of the trapezoid block is fixedly connected There is the first non-slip mat.
Preferably, the both sides of the top of the box have been fixedly connected with spring lever, and the top of spring lever and support plate Bottom is fixedly connected.
Preferably, arc groove is offered at the top of the rack, the inner wall of the arc groove is fixedly connected with Two non-slip mats.
Compared with prior art, the beneficial effects of the utility model are as follows:
1, the utility model is by being arranged motor, runner, pivot pin, activity box, connecting rod, mobile bar, motion bar, movable plate With being used cooperatively for movable plate, it is height-adjustable to solve the problems, such as that existing weaving creel does not have, the adjustable height Weaving creel, have height-adjustable advantage, convenient for staff place or remove tube, reduce peril Generation, reduce the working strength of staff, improve work efficiency, be conducive to the development and use of textile mills, be worth It promotes the use of.
2, the utility model can effectively enhance friction of the babinet to ground by the way that trapezoid block and the first non-slip mat is arranged Power prevents babinet from the phenomenon that displacement occur, by the way that spring lever is arranged, can effectively avoid support plate from occurring during lifting The phenomenon that inclination, improves the stationarity of support plate, by the way that arc groove and the second non-slip mat is arranged, can effectively prevent yarn The phenomenon that cylinder slides, improves the stationarity to tube.

Specific implementation mode
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are without making creative work The every other embodiment obtained, shall fall within the protection scope of the present invention.
- 3 are please referred to Fig.1, a kind of height-adjustable weaving creel, including babinet 1, the both sides of 1 bottom of babinet are solid Surely it is connected with trapezoid block 25, the bottom of trapezoid block 25 is fixedly connected with the first non-slip mat 26, by the way that trapezoid block 25 and first is arranged Non-slip mat 26 can effectively enhance frictional force of the babinet 1 to ground, prevent babinet 1 from the phenomenon that displacement occur, 1 inner cavity of babinet Bottom is fixedly connected with holder 2, and the top of holder 2 is fixedly connected with motor 3, and the output end of motor 3 is fixedly connected with runner 4, The front of runner 4 is fixedly connected with pivot pin 5, and the surface of pivot pin 5 slidably connects activity box 6, and the left side of activity box 6 is fixedly connected There are connecting rod 7, the left side of connecting rod 7 to be fixedly connected with mobile bar 8, the bottom of mobile bar 8 is fixedly connected with the first sliding block 9, case The bottom of 1 inner cavity of body offers the first sliding groove 10, and the inner wall of the first sliding groove 10 is connect with the basal sliding of the first sliding block 9, moves The top of lever 8 is fixedly connected with the first strut 11, and fixed block 12 is fixedly connected on the left of 1 inner cavity of babinet, and fixed block 12 is remote Side from babinet 1 is connected with motion bar 13, and the front of motion bar 13 offers the first loose slot 14, and the first loose slot The surface of 14 inner wall and the first strut 11 is slidably connected, and the one end of motion bar 13 far from fixed block 12 is fixedly connected with second The inner cavity of bar 15, babinet 1 is provided with movable plate 16, and the bottom of movable plate 16 is fixedly connected with movable plate 17, and movable plate 17 is just Face offers the second loose slot 18, and the inner wall of the second loose slot 18 and the surface of the second strut 15 are slidably connected, movable plate 16 Both sides be fixedly connected with the second sliding block 19, the both sides of 1 inner cavity of babinet offer second sliding slot 20, and second sliding slot 20 Inner wall is slidably connected with the second side of the sliding block 19 far from movable plate 16, and the top of babinet 1 offers straight slot 21, movable plate 16 Top is fixedly connected with portable pillar 22, and the top of portable pillar 22 is through to the top of straight slot 21 and is fixedly connected with support plate 23, The both sides at 1 top of babinet have been fixedly connected with spring lever 27, and the top of spring lever 27 is fixedly connected with the bottom of support plate 23, The phenomenon that by the way that spring lever 27 is arranged, can effectively avoid support plate 23 from being tilted during lifting, improve support The both sides of the stationarity of plate 23,23 top of support plate have been fixedly connected with rack 24, and the top of rack 24 offers arc The inner wall of groove 28, arc groove 28 is fixedly connected with the second non-slip mat 29, by the way that arc groove 28 and the second non-slip mat is arranged 29, the phenomenon that tube slides can be effectively prevented, improve the stationarity to tube, by be arranged motor 3, runner 4, Pivot pin 5, activity box 6, connecting rod 7, mobile bar 8, motion bar 13, movable plate 16 and movable plate 17 are used cooperatively, and are solved existing Some weaving creels do not have height-adjustable problem, the height-adjustable weaving creel, have adjustable height The advantages of, it is placed convenient for staff or removes tube, reduced the generation of peril, reduce the work of staff Intensity improves work efficiency, and is conducive to the development and use of textile mills, is worth of widely use.
In use, user drives runner 4 to rotate by starting motor 3, motor 3, pass through matching for pivot pin 5 and activity box 6 It closes and uses, make activity box 6 that connecting rod 7 be driven to be moved to the left, connecting rod 7 drives mobile bar 8 to be moved to the left, and passes through the first strut 11 With being used cooperatively for the first loose slot 14, so that mobile bar 8 is driven 13 counter-clockwise swing of motion bar, pass through the second strut 15 and second Loose slot 18 is used cooperatively, and drives movable plate 17 to move up while 13 counter-clockwise swing of motion bar, 17 band of movable plate Dynamic movable plate 16 moves up, and movable plate 16 drives portable pillar 22 to move up, and portable pillar 22 drives support plate 23 to move up, So as to achieve the purpose that adjust height.
In summary:The height-adjustable weaving creel, by be arranged motor 3, runner 4, pivot pin 5, activity box 6, Connecting rod 7, mobile bar 8, motion bar 13, movable plate 16 and movable plate 17 are used cooperatively, and solve existing weaving creel Do not have height-adjustable problem.
